Animal Biotechnology: Emerging Breeding Technologies provides a comprehensive overview of the latest genetic tools and techniques used in modern animal breeding. The book covers a wide range of topics, from the basics of molecular genetics to the most advanced applications of gene editing and genetic engineering. It also includes case studies and examples of how these technologies are being used to improve the health, productivity, and welfare of animals.

The first volume of Animal Biotechnology focused on the basic principles and applications of genetics in animal breeding. This second volume builds on that foundation by providing a detailed overview of the most recent advances in the field. It covers everything from the use of molecular markers to identify and select for desirable traits to the development of new genetic engineering techniques that can be used to create animals with specific genetic modifications.

Animal Biotechnology: Emerging Breeding Technologies is an essential resource for anyone who is interested in the latest advances in animal breeding. It provides a comprehensive overview of the field, and it is written in a way that is accessible to both scientists and non-scientists alike.
